Twelve persons lost their lives in an auto crash on Gusau-Funtua Road, the sector commandant of the Federal Roads Safety Corps (FRSC) in Zamfara State, Mr Iro Danladi, has said.
Danladi told the News Agency of Nigeria (NAN) that the accident involved an 18-seater bus belonging to Zamfara State Mass Transport Company and a truck.
The bus was carrying 25 passengers at the time of the accident, he said.
Danladi said the other 13 passengers sustained injuries and were all admitted at the General Hospital, Tsafe in Zamfara.
The sector commandant blamed the crash on over-speeding and wrongful overtaking leading to a head-on collision.
Danladi warned drivers against over-speeding, wrongful overtaking and overloading, among other traffic offences. (NAN).
